### LemonLDAP
[LemonLDAP::NG][lemonldap] is an open-source IdP solution.
1. Create an OpenID Connect Relying Parties in LemonLDAP::NG
2. The parameters are:
- Client ID under the basic menu of the new Relying Parties (`Options > Basic >
Client ID`)
- Client secret (`Options > Basic > Client secret`)
- JWT Algorithm: RS256 within the security menu of the new Relying Parties
(`Options > Security > ID Token signature algorithm` and `Options > Security >
Access Token signature algorithm`)
- Scopes: OpenID, Email and Profile
- Allowed redirection addresses for login (`Options > Basic > Allowed
redirection addresses for login` ) :
`[synapse public baseurl]/_synapse/client/oidc/callback`
Synapse config:
```yaml
oidc_providers:
- idp_id: lemonldap
idp_name: lemonldap
discover: true
issuer: "https://auth.example.org/" # TO BE FILLED: replace with your domain
client_id: "your client id" # TO BE FILLED
client_secret: "your client secret" # TO BE FILLED
scopes:
- "openid"
- "profile"
- "email"
user_mapping_provider:
config:
localpart_template: "{{ user.preferred_username }}}"
# TO BE FILLED: If your users have names in LemonLDAP::NG and you want those in Synapse, this should be replaced with user.name|capitalize or any valid filter.
display_name_template: "{{ user.preferred_username|capitalize }}"
```

# Background Updates API
This API allows a server administrator to manage the background updates being
run against the database.
## Status
This API gets the current status of the background updates.
The API is:
```
GET /_synapse/admin/v1/background_updates/status
```
Returning:
```json
{
"enabled": true,
"current_updates": {
"<db_name>": {
"name": "<background_update_name>",
"total_item_count": 50,
"total_duration_ms": 10000.0,
"average_items_per_ms": 2.2,
},
}
}
```
`enabled` whether the background updates are enabled or disabled.
`db_name` the database name (usually Synapse is configured with a single database named 'master').
For each update:
`name` the name of the update.
`total_item_count` total number of "items" processed (the meaning of 'items' depends on the update in question).
`total_duration_ms` how long the background process has been running, not including time spent sleeping.
`average_items_per_ms` how many items are processed per millisecond based on an exponential average.
## Enabled
This API allow pausing background updates.
Background updates should *not* be paused for significant periods of time, as
this can affect the performance of Synapse.
*Note*: This won't persist over restarts.
*Note*: This won't cancel any update query that is currently running. This is
usually fine since most queries are short lived, except for `CREATE INDEX`
background updates which won't be cancelled once started.
The API is:
```
POST /_synapse/admin/v1/background_updates/enabled
```
with the following body:
```json
{
"enabled": false
}
```
`enabled` sets whether the background updates are enabled or disabled.
The API returns the `enabled` param.
```json
{
"enabled": false
}
```
There is also a `GET` version which returns the `enabled` state.
